Safety secured for Getafe

A 1-1 draw for the side from Madrid with Eibar was enough to secure safety for Pablo Franco's side, leaving the Basque outfit with work to do on the final day of the season.

he points were shared in the south of Madrid as Getafe and Eibar drew 1-1 in a result that sees the home side's safety in Liga BBVA secured. The Basque outfit will need to secure their safety next weekend at home to Córdoba.

The home side started the game less nervous, linking up well and taking advantage of Eibar's apparent tension, despite the fact thousands of fans had travelled from Guipúzcoa to the Coliseum Alfonso Pérez to support them. Little by little Gaizka Garitano's side came back into the game, and after half an hour had s golden opportunity to take the lead through Mikel Arruabarrena. However, just as the visitors were looking strong, Freddy Hinestroza put Pablo Franco's side ahead after a pinpoint corner taken by Pedro León. The home side's joy was short lived as Borja Fernández levelled things up shortly after with a header.

In the second half Eibar dominated possession and hit the post eight minutes after the restart through goalscorer Arruabarrena. The visitors did not want things to go down to the wire, and they started to pepper Vicente Guaita's goal. After 73' Getafe responded with a chance that bounced back off the post, and the game finished all square.
